WebJun 30, 2016 · What is an SNDA? An SNDA, or subordination (the “S”), non-disturbance (the “ND”) and attornment (the “A”) agreement, is an agreement between the lender providing financing to the landlord and a tenant of the property. WebApr 15, 2014 · SNDAs create a direct contractual relationship between the lender and the tenants of the property that secures a commercial mortgage loan. Both lenders and tenants commonly require SNDAs to... WebAug 2, 2024 · An SNDA is entered into by the lender of a commercial landlord and the landlord’s tenant. It establishes the protocol should the landlord default under a mortgage or other financing agreement with the lender and the lender then becomes the new owner of the property as a result of a foreclosure. WebIn circumstances where Tenant has the ability to negotiate the SNDA, Tenant should focus on how, among other things, the treatment of tenant allowances, set-off rights, rent abatements, security deposits and options (e.g. rights of first offer or rights of first refusal), are altered by the term of the SNDA and the Loan Documents.

WebMay 7, 2024 · When reviewing an SNDA from the lender’s perspective, a reviewer’s goal in negotiating an SNDA is to try to limit the lender’s lease obligations as much as possible, while conversely the tenant endeavors to protect as many of the rights it negotiated in the lease agreement.
